In this second episode of the 1930s podcast series, I have dug
into the vault to re-package a classic Dickheads podcast episode
from our first season in 2018 when we were gathering in the
studio.  In this episode, we cover 'Alas, All Thinking' by
Harry Bates most famous for writing the story that inspired the
Day the Earth Stood Still. Originally published in the June 1935
issue of Astounding Magazine, a young Philip K. Dick considered
this one of his favorite Science Fiction stories and a major
influence on his writing.
